Orange Cattleya height is 45.70 cm and width 45.70 cm whereas Rhynchostylis Gigantea height is 40.60 cm and width 50.80 cm. The color specification of Orange Cattleya and Rhynchostylis Gigantea are as follows:
Orange Cattleya flower color: Orange, Gold and Orange Red
Orange Cattleya leaf color: Green and Light Green
Rhynchostylis Gigantea flower color: White, Lavender, Violet and Plum
Care of Orange Cattleya and Rhynchostylis Gigantea include pruning, fertilizers, watering etc. Orange Cattleya pruning is done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ves and Rhynchostylis Gigantea pruning is done Remove dead branches. In summer Orange Cattleya need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water. Whereas, in summer Rhynchostylis Gigantea needs Moderate and in winter, it needs Average Water.
